At last I have completed the final tutorial and it is attached below. It covers the use of the wire/metallic patterns created in Parts 1 and 2 and their transformation in GIMP and GMIC.

As usual it is geared at GIMP neophytes (love that word) and essentially it should foster further exploration of GIMP and GMIC - a longer journey :)
